62597 Avanceret Internetteknologi

2016/2017

Informatik(100)
IT, Ballerup: valgfag
Softwareteknologi: Valgfag
Kursusinformation
Advanced Internet Technology
Dansk
5
Diplomingeniør
Kurset udbydes under tompladsordningen
Forår
Kl.17:00-20:30
Campus Ballerup
Gennemgang af teori på forelæsningsform, workshops samt praktisk arbejde.
[Kurset følger ikke DTUs normale skemastruktur]
Aftales med underviser, Oplyses på CampusNet
Mundtlig eksamen
7-trins skala , ekstern censur
62509
Roger Munck-Fairwood , Ballerup Campus, Bygning Ballerup, Tlf. (+45) 3588 5188 , romu@dtu.dk

62 DTU Diplom
Se www.cv.diplom.dtu.dk
I studieplanlæggeren
Overordnede kursusmål
Modulet Avanceret Internetteknologi arbejder med implementering af avancerede tjenester på internettet. På modulet undervises i de nyeste teknologier inden for aktive løsninger på internettet med brug af databaser og lignende. På modulet arbejdes der med den nyeste server-teknologi som hos for avancerede tjenester. Avancerede grafiske brugerflader gennemgås, ligesom sessioner og generel tilstandsstyring gennemgås. Der arbejdes ligeledes med avancerede Caching-principper. Der arbejdes ligeledes med systemopbygning, der er baseret på den objektorienterede tankegang. Derudover analyseres sikkerhedsproblemer i avanceret internetteknologi. Endelig arbejdes der med opbygning af web-services.
Læringsmål
En studerende, der fuldt ud har opfyldt kursets mål, vil kunne:
  • Skal have viden om opsætning af web-servere (Viden og forståelse)
  • Skal have viden om implementering af avancerede grafiske brugerflader (Viden og forståelse)
  • Skal have viden om opbygning af avancerede grafiske brugerflader (Viden og forståelse)
  • Skal have viden om opbygning af sessioner (Viden og forståelse)
  • Skal have viden om opbygning af sikre web-løsninger (Viden og forståelse)
  • Skal have kendskab til opbygning af web-services (Viden og forståelse)
  • Skal have kendskab til det valgte programmeringssprogs avancerede dele (Viden og forståelse)
  • Skal have kendskab til relevante videnskabsteoretiske metoder (Viden og forståelse)
Kursusindhold
Læringsmål: (fortsat)
Færdigheder:
• Skal kunne implementere en avanceret web-løsning med database
• Skal kunne opdele en avanceret web-løsning efter objektorienterede principper med brug af objektorienteret programmering
• Skal kunne sikkerhedsteste en web-løsning
• Skal kunne teste en applikation og udfærdige en testrapport
Kompetencer:
• Skal kunne udvikle en større web-løsning med brug af databaser
• Skal kunne dokumentere en applikations funktionalitet og sikkerhed gennem test.

Indhold:
• Avancerede internet-løsninger
• Databaser og web
• Sikkerhedsproblemer i web-løsninger
• Web-services
Litteraturhenvisninger
Oplyses senere
Sidst opdateret
20. juni, 2016